Program Description
contribute to the development, implementation, and evaluation of employee recruitment, selection, and retention plans and processes; administer and contribute to the design and evaluation of the performance management program; develop, implement, and evaluate employee orientation, training, and development programs; facilitate and support effective employee and labour relations in both non-union and union environments; research and support the development and communication of the organization’s total compensation plan; collaborate with others, in the development, implementation, and evaluation of organizational health and safety policies and practices;

Study and Work in Canada
Full-time undergraduate and post-graduate international students can work anywhere on or off campus without a work permit. The rules around the number of hours a student will be allowed to work may vary based on the country the student chooses to study in. International students are typically able to work up to 20 hours a week.
